回 帖 发 新 帖 刷新版面

主题:数据库信息显示到文本框中哪出错了啊

我要对数据库中的内容进行更新,但前提是我要把不更新的给显示到文本框中,代码是这样的,希望大家给些意见,

<% 
dim number
number=request.Form("number")
            
dim conn
 set conn=server.createobject("adodb.Connection")
 conn.connectionString="Dbq=C:\Inetpub\wwwroot\canting.mdb;Driver={Microsoft Access Driver (*.mdb)}"
 conn.connectiontimeout=30
  conn.mode=0
  conn.open

dim comm
set comm=server.CreateObject("adodb.Command")
comm.ActiveConnection=conn
comm.commandtype=1
dim sqlstr
sqlstr="Select * from caipu where name='"&number&"'"
comm.commandtext=sqlstr
set rs=comm.execute
if not rs.eof and not rs.bof then
%>
<form class="STYLE1" action="modify1.asp" method="post">

  <p>请修改以下信息:</p>
  <table width="200" border="1" align="center">
  
    <tr>
      <td width="109"><div align="center">编号</div></td>
      <td width="190"><label>
        <input name="number" type="text" id="number" size="16" value="<%=rs("number")%>" readonly="yes"/>
      </label></td>
    </tr>
    <tr>
      <td><div align="center">菜名</div></td>
      <td><label>
        <input name="name" type="text" id="name" size="16" value="<%=rs("name")%>" readonly="yes"/>
      </label></td>
    </tr>
    <tr>
      <td><label>
        <div align="center">价格</div>
      </label></td>
      <td><input name="price" type="text" id="price" size="16" value="<%=rs("price")%>" /></td>
    </tr>
    <tr>
      <td height="31" colspan="2"><table width="200" border="0">
        <tr>
          <td>&nbsp;</td>
          <td><label>
            <input name="modify" type="submit" id="modify" value="修改" />
          </label></td>
          <td>&nbsp;</td>
        </tr>
      </table></td>
    </tr>
  </table>
  <p>&nbsp;  </p>
</form>
<%  end if

conn.close
set conn=nothing
%>

回复列表 (共1个回复)

沙发


程序提示什么错误啊?

我来回复

您尚未登录,请登录后再回复。点此登录或注册